  • 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:
 
    • The Hardware Asset Management (HAM) Analyst is responsible for assisting with the management of the lifecycle of all corporate-owned IT hardware assets (laptops, desktops, etc.) in accordance with best practices and internal processes and procedures
    • The Hardware Asset Analyst strives to provide best-in-class asset management services to our internal clients
    • Understand the lifecycle status framework as defined by the ITAM Program
    • Support implemented Operational processes as required for Hardware Families/Classes
    • Process lists of retired assets and reconcile against disposal vendor data as required to ensure compliance to established SLA's
    • Support physical stockroom inventory efforts
    • Govern repository Data for Hardware Families/Classes in Operation
    • Monitor Asset Management Data as defined in Daily Checklists and notify responsible areas of any required changes/corrections
    • Manage shrink reporting (Deployed, Stock, etc.)
    • Perform Reconciliations and Data Analysis as required
    • Work with the Implementation team on moving new Hardware Families/Classes to Operations
    • Provide adhoc reporting on asset data as needed
    • Write & Update procedures to support Hardware Asset Management
    • In depth knowledge of asset lifecycle and best practices with a strong focus on data quality.
    • Exercise independent judgment and decision-making on complex issues regarding job duties and related tasks, and works under minimal supervision
    • Gain additional knowledge and stay abreast of current technologies through employee and company sponsored training, periodicals, and regular interaction with other team members.
    • Will report to the Lead, Service Offering Management, IT Ops-IT Service Operations
 
  • REQUIRED KNOWLEDGE, EDUCATION AND/OR EXPERIENCE:
    • Bachelor's Degree or equivalent work experience
    • 3+ years of Hardware Asset Management experience
    • Experience with any Asset Management toolset
    • Proficient in Microsoft Office Applications (Access, Excel, PowerPoint) with a strong knowledge of MS Excel and Access
